The market is estimated at approximately USD 475 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ach approximately USD 620 Million by 2030, expanding at a compound annual growth rate of roughly 5.5 percent.
A capital equipment platform used in stereotactic radiosurgery. This report describes the category strictly as a market segment.
North America and Europe together account for the largest regional concentration, while Asia-Pacific forms the fastest-growing region tied to oncology programme expansion and government tender activity.
Oncology programme expansion and neurosurgery capacity growth is the leading driver, alongside technology modernisation among institutions operating earlier installed platforms.
The Icon is Elekta's current-generation platform, while earlier installed platforms remain in active clinical use across a large share of the more than 360-unit global installed base, a distinction that shapes which service, software and upgrade path a centre follows.
Brain metastases, acoustic neuroma, meningioma, arteriovenous malformations, trigeminal neuralgia, pituitary adenoma, gliomas, functional neurosurgery applications and other intracranial disorders are the nine treatment indication categories tracked in this report.
Academic medical centres, cancer hospitals and government healthcare institutions most commonly procure these systems, working through tender-based, direct purchase or strategic partnership procurement models.
FDA-regulated markets, CE-Mark markets and emerging regulatory jurisdictions together govern product approval and market entry sequencing.
Elekta manufactures the Leksell Gamma Knife platform itself, alongside a broader competitive landscape of diversified radiotherapy manufacturers and specialised radiosurgery technology providers covered in the full report.
